php生成二维码并下载图片(适应于框架)
首先,需要下载并安装相应的二维码生成扩展。通过搜索引擎可以找到相关的PHP二维码生成库,通常使用Composer进行安装。例如,使用以下命令:
发布日期:2025-05-04 15:26:23
浏览次数:6
分类:精选文章
本文共 650 字,大约阅读时间需要 2 分钟。
为了实现二维码生成和下载功能,以下是详细的实现步骤:
composer require phpqrcode/qrcode
安装完成后,确保扩展库已经正确加载到项目中。
- 接下来,需要在项目中引入二维码生成类。可以通过以下方式实现:
- 使用自动加载功能:
- 或者根据项目结构手动引入类文件。
- 实现二维码生成和下载逻辑。首先,确保传入的URL参数有效:
- 图片宽度:
$width = 100; - 图片大小:
$size = floor($width/27*100)/100 + 0.01; - 容错级别:
$errorCorrectionLevel = 2; - 图像点大小:
$matrixPointSize = (int)$size;
require 'your/path/vendor/autoload.php';use PhpQr\QRcode;
if (!isset($url)) { $this->error('参数非法'); return;}$url = trim($url); 然后,设置二维码的基本参数:
最后,生成二维码并下载:
QRcode::create($url, $size, $errorCorrectionLevel, $matrixPointSize)->download();
以上代码需根据实际需求调整参数,确保生成的二维码符合预期。
发表评论
最新留言
留言是一种美德,欢迎回访!
[***.207.175.100]2026年06月07日 05时46分54秒
关于作者
喝酒易醉,品茶养心,人生如梦,品茶悟道,何以解忧?唯有杜康!
-- 愿君每日到此一游!
推荐文章
php设置socket超时时间
2023-03-02
php设计模式 萨莱 pdf,PHP设计模式 建造者模式
2023-03-02
PHP设计模式之----观察者模式
2023-03-02
php设计模式之装饰器模式
2023-03-02
R&Python Data Science系列:数据处理(5)--字符串函数基于R(一)
2023-03-02
PHP设计模式:观察者模式
2023-03-02
php访问mysql(1)
2023-03-02
php详细学习1
2023-03-02
php语言优劣
2023-03-02
PHP语言最优雅的支付SDK扩展包
2023-03-02